Portezuelo, Hidalgo, Mexico
Overview
Portezuelo is a small town in Hidalgo, Mexico, known for its tranquil atmosphere and rich local culture. With a population under 2,000, it offers a glimpse into rural Mexican life and traditions. Visitors are welcomed by friendly locals, historic sites, and picturesque landscapes.
Best Time to Visit
November-April for dry, pleasant weather
Local Tips
Bring cash, as card acceptance is limited at small businesses. Weekdays are quieter, while weekends may feature local events in the plaza.
Cultural Etiquette
Casual dress is common; greet locals with a polite 'buenos días.' Tipping 10% is appreciated in eateries, and respect local customs, especially in religious settings.
Safety Warnings
Centro and San Francisco are generally safe; exercise caution on remote trails in El Mirador, especially after dark. Petty theft is rare but keep valuables secure.
Hidden Gems
Don't miss the artisan workshops in Barrio La Ermita and the hillside views from El Mirador. Try the locally-baked pan dulce available only at the Sunday market.
